The Museum of Defense.
The Tula Defense Museum is the only museum in the region where the heroic defense of Tula, which went down in the history of the Great Patriotic War as one of the brightest and most significant pages, is shown on such a large scale.
The exhibition features over 60 software and hardware complexes that allow each visitor to find interesting and important things for themselves.
Electronic encyclopedias reveal to experts and fans of military history not only the period of the city's defense, but also the history of the region during the war, and various interactive programs make it possible to find out in a playful way what was in the ambulance bag and sent to the front, what a Molotov cocktail is and how Tula was heated in the harsh winter of 1941.
Museum visitors will see more than 1,000 authentic wartime objects.

The Tula Gingerbread Museum is the first gingerbread museum in Russia, opened at the Staraya Tula confectionery factory back in 1996.
The guides will take you on a fascinating tour and immerse you in the era of the gingerbread masters of the 19th century.
They will tell about the history of the Tula printed gingerbread, how the history of the production of the Staraya Tula factory developed and traditions were formed.
You will see a unique exhibition that has been collected for decades.
You will feel how interesting it is to touch the history of bygone years by looking at old photographs and original documents.
